  1. The Corn Is Green is a 1979 American made-for-television drama film starring Katharine Hepburn as a schoolteacher determined to bring education to a Welsh coal mining town, despite great opposition.

  2. The Corn Is Green: Directed by George Cukor. With Katharine Hepburn, Ian Saynor, Bill Fraser, Patricia Hayes. A strong-willed teacher, determined to educate the poor and illiterate youth of an impoverished Welsh village, discovers one student whom she believes to have the seeds of genius in him.
